Question 9: ADH (Antidiuretic Hormone) plays a crucial role in regulating water balance in the body by increasing water reabsorption. This process primarily occurs in the kidneys. The correct option is B) kidney.
Question 10: A human body cell (somatic cell) is diploid () and contains a full set of DNA. A human gamete (sperm or egg cell) is haploid () and contains half the amount of DNA found in a somatic cell. Given that the mass of DNA in a human body cell is approximately 6.5 picograms (pg), the mass of DNA in a human gamete would be half of that. The closest option is A) 3.2 pg.
